Understanding Alcohol Content
The alcohol content in beverages is measured in terms of percentage of alcohol by volume (ABV). This measurement indicates how much pure alcohol is contained in a given volume of the drink. Both sake and wine have varying levels of ABV, depending on factors like the type, brand, and production methods.
How Alcohol Content is Determined
The ABV of sake and wine is determined during the fermentation process. For wine, the natural yeast on the grapes ferments the sugars, producing alcohol. The resulting ABV can range from about 5% for some dessert wines to over 15% for certain red wines. Sake production involves fermenting rice, water, and koji (a type of fungus), leading to a beverage that typically ranges from 14% to 16% ABV, although some varieties can have higher or lower alcohol content.

Factors Influencing Sake’s Alcohol Content
Several factors can influence the final ABV of sake, including the type of rice used, the polishing ratio (how much of the rice grain is polished away), and the brewing technique. Junmai sake, for example, made without added brewer’s alcohol, tends to have a lower ABV compared to other types. On the other hand, ginjo and daiginjo sakes, which involve more labor-intensive and precise brewing methods, can have slightly higher alcohol content due to their detailed production process.
Typical ABV Range for Sake
Most sakes have an ABV ranging from 14% to 16%. However, some can have an ABV as low as 13% or as high as 17%, depending on the specific brewing style and the brewer’s intent. Understanding this range is essential for those looking to explore the world of sake responsibly.

Factors Influencing Wine’s Alcohol Content
The alcohol level in wine is primarily determined by the amount of sugar in the grapes at harvest and the efficiency of the fermentation process. Wines from warmer regions, like Australia and parts of California, tend to have higher ABV levels due to the riper grapes, which contain more sugar. In contrast, wines from cooler climates, such as Germany and parts of France, often have lower ABV levels because the grapes are less ripe and contain less sugar.
Typical ABV Range for Wine
The ABV of wine can range widely, from around 5% for certain dessert wines to over 15% for some full-bodied reds. On average, most table wines have an ABV between 11% and 13.5%. Sparkling wines, like champagne, tend to have a lower ABV, typically between 11% and 12.5%, due to the specifics of their fermentation and production methods.
Comparing Sake and Wine Alcohol Content
When comparing the alcohol content of sake and wine, it’s clear that both beverages have the potential to offer a wide range of ABV levels. However, sake tends to have a more consistent ABV, generally falling within a narrower range compared to the broad spectrum seen in wines.
